The season opener looms, as the classic ends.

The Twins have been playing well this spring and it gives them confidence heading into the season.  Opening day is less than two weeks away and the roster is falling into place.  One key part that will not be in the lineup-opening day will be catcher Joe Mauer.  The reigning AL batting champ will be out for an a few weeks to start the season with an ailing back injury that has plagued him all spring.  While Mauer is sidelined veteran backup Mike Redmond will be behind the plate.  Redmond has had enough experience to handle the starting role. 

 

There have been some good performances throughout the spring by the Twins.  Leading the way for the regular players has been Alexi Cassila and Jason Kubel.  Both of these players are hitting over .340 throughout the spring.  On the pitching mound all five of the projected starters have an era of fewer than 3.00.  Leading the way has been Kevin Slowey.  He has an era of fewer then 2.00 runs per game.  The Twins appear to be in good shape heading into the season opener.  With the pitchers performing well and the offence being as balanced as any team in the league, they seem ready to make a run at another central division title. 

 

This past week the World Baseball Classic concluded its second tournament.  Taking the crown again was team Japan.  Japan defeated team Korea 5-3 in 10 innings in the championship game.  This was the third time in the tournament that the two teams had played, Korea winning the first two meetings.   Team Japan defeated team USA in the semi-finals by a score of 9-4.  Many thought that this team USA was the team that could have brought home the gold.  One bit of criticism that has been given to this team USA was that they did not play with as much passion as the other countries.   The media feels that the players of team USA were distracted by the upcoming season and trying to stay healthy.  Winning the WBC would just have been a bonus.  The players on team USA deny this.  Players such as Mets third baseman David Wright say that they were just as excited as the other teams.  We will have to see in four years if the classic stays the way it is or does it change to make the best players playing.
